Position Summary

The Preventative Maintenance Technician is responsible for performing scheduled maintenance, inspections, and minor repairs on natural gas compression equipment to ensure optimal performance, reliability, and compliance with safety and environmental standards. This role requires strong mechanical aptitude, attention to detail, and the ability to work independently in field environments.

Key Responsibilities

  • Conduct routine preventative maintenance on natural gas compression units, including engines, compressors, and auxiliary systems.
  • Inspect equipment for wear, leaks, and potential failures; document findings and recommend corrective actions.
  • Replace filters, fluids, belts, and other consumable components as per maintenance schedules.
  • Perform minor troubleshooting and repairs to maintain operational efficiency.
  • Maintain accurate records of maintenance activities, parts usage, and equipment performance.
  • Ensure compliance with company safety policies, environmental regulations, and industry standards.
  • Communicate effectively with supervisors and other team members regarding equipment status and repair needs.
  • Operate and maintain tools, vehicles, and diagnostic equipment in good working condition.
